To help preserve audiovisual heritage in the pacific northwest by assisting heritage organizations with the conversion of analog video to digital formats according to archival best practices.

Top pay as a share of expenses
In 2024, the highest total compensation at Moving Image Preservation of Puget Sound equaled 12% of the organization's total expenses. The median for arts, culture & humanities organizations is 11%.
Based on 17,098 arts, culture & humanities organizations, each measured at its most recent filing year with reported expenses and compensation.

What are Moving Image Preservation of Puget Sound's revenue and expenses?
In 2024, Moving Image Preservation of Puget Sound reported $387k in total revenue and $220k in total expenses on its IRS Form 990.
